Transaction 8592a15b36e225c91bc9d96024eca14195d8da5b0a84dafd8e298f8671399a3c
1 Input
1 Output
-
8592a15b36e225c91bc9d96024eca14195d8da5b0a84dafd8e298f8671399a3c:0
- value
- 572541
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 46a3647650fc4d8583f794db472e89df6cc08282 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17SW38j9Jqfz3bT3uEvBqPDdxLn3gbxKGy